Hey everyone..so I have been around these boards for awhile now, always reading but never really commenting. I would LOVE to host an all-star weekend!! However, I hate to rain on everyone's parade. About 3 years ago I had a friend who worked for the Bobcats in the season ticket sales office, I asked her this exact questions. "When will Charlotte host the All-Star game." Her comment to me was: We've been told by the league that we don't have anywhere NEAR the accommodations (hotel rooms) it would take to even be remotely considered for hosting an all-star game. Now, I know that within the past couple years since she's been gone, we've added hotel rooms, etc. but from the extent that she made it seem...we'd need A LOT more to be considered. Like I said, I hate to rain on everyone's parade but just wanted to share what I had heard (and yes, this was 3 years ago so maybe we've made strides). Keep up the great work on the board!

I have always wondered what All Star Games did to attendance for the franchises that hosted it. Maybe the game would drive more interest in the fans of that city. So I looked at the last 12 years, 11 cities (Las Vegas), to see if there was any kind of spike in attendance from the year before the host, the year of the host, and the year after the host.

Well, this was pointless because there is no spike or decline in fan attendance. On average there was a 1% increase from the year before to the year after. 2% increase from the year of to the year after. The big spikes positive and negative can be attributed to players(Dwight Howard twice) and winning and losing. So it doesn't really drum up much interest for fan attendance I do think that it would help get better players here which will progress this franchise tremendously.

i have very fond memories of the 1991 all-star game in charlotte. my dad took me to the game when i was a senior in high school. he somehow scored tickets thru his work. i believe it was the only time he and i went to a game together during the time the hornets were in town. he was a big sports fan, but never really had much interest in going to live games. whenever he would get hornets tix, he would just tell me to take a friend. after i came back from college, his health didnt really allow him to go to games. too much walking.

our seats were upper level and that place was jam packed, as always. i remember the national anthem was quite moving, because the game occurred around the time that desert storm commenced. bruce hornsby and branford marsailis nailed it. (see below)
